Chicago Has The The World's Largest...

1. ...collection of Impressionist paintings.
(Outside the Louvre, that is!) In fact, the Art Institute's entire Department of Modern and Contemporary Art is considered one of the most comprehensive in the world. Among its holdings: late Water Lilies by Claude Monet, works by Picasso, and paintings by Henri Matisse.

2. ...contemporary art museum.
With a membership that surpasses the 15,000 mark, the Museum of Contemporary Art is on a mission to collect, preserve, and interpret the art of our time. The MCA documents contemporary visual culture through painting, sculpture, photography, video, film, and performance.

3. ...convention facility.
McCormick Place has over 2.2 million square feet of space. It also has 8 restaurants, 25 concession stands, 122 restrooms, some 700 pay phones, and a 1000-seat outdoor terrace.

4. ...dental library.
The American Dental Association is the accrediting agency for 1,242 dental educational and dental auxiliary educational programs in the United States. Its library has approximately 33,000 books and 17,500 bound journal volumes.

5. ...futures and options marketplace.
The Chicago Board of Trade.

6. ...indoor aquarium.
The Shedd, also known as "The World's Aquarium," is a non-profit institution committed to the conservation of aquatic life and its environments. Its Oceanarium is the world's largest indoor marine mammal pavilion.

7. ...manufacturer of chewing gum.
The Wm. Wrigley Jr. Company is well-known in Chicago not only because of its chewing gum, but also because it is the owner of the Wrigley Building and because it was the original owner of those "lovable losers," the Chicago Cubs.

8. ...public library.
The 756,640 square foot Harold Washington Library Center, opened in 1991. The nine-floor library has five-story-tall arched windows. It also has a Lower Level which contains a 385-seat paneled auditorium, an exhibit hall, and a video theater.

9. ...Tiffany Dome.
The Chicago Cultural Center (the first free, municipal cultural center in the US), recently celebrated its 100th anniversary. Originally built as the city's first permanent public library, its beaux-arts style features two spectacular stained-glass domes as well as intricate, coffered ceilings.

10. ...Tyrannosaurus Rex skeleton.
Discovered in 1990 in the badlands of New Mexico, Sue, is not only the largest but also the most complete T. Rex skeleton ever discovered. She is 42 feet long, with a five feet skull... and a brain cavity that is just big enough to hold a quart of milk.

Other big things in Chicago:

  • Nabisco, the world's largest cookie and cracker factory, is located in Chicago (7300 S. Kedzie Avenue).
  • The world's largest ice cream cone factory, Keebler, is also located in Chicago (10839 S. Langley Avenue).
  • Brach and Brock, located at 401 N. Cicero Avenue in Chicago, is the world's largest candy factory.
  • The Taste of Chicago is the world's largest free outdoor food festival. It attracted over 3.5 million people in 2003.
